I'm trying to get my head around the following configuration:
I want to setup Cyrus SASL such that it will look up a OpenLDAP
directory tree to retrieve the password for authentication. Cyrus SASL
and OpenLDAP will provide authentication services for Cyrus IMAP as well
as Postfix.
From Googling about for the last 3 hours, I have been able to gather
that I should define the following inside /etc/saslauthd.conf:
ldap_servers
ldap_bind_dn
ldap_bind_pw
ldap_search_base
But this will only work if the username is a UID in the tree. For my
purposes, I need SASL to look up the mail attribute and get the
corresponding password.
Is there a parameter that will allow me to define a LDAP search string?
Thanks in advance !
man imapd.conf
scroll down until you get to the ldap_filter parameter
